Job Description
New Era Player Development is seeking an enthusiastic and motivated ice hockey advisor/coach. Your role will be to work with our clients by helping implement the NEPD development plan and advocate on behalf of our clients to Junior and College programs in North America.
Essential Functions:
- Attend Games, Showcases and Camps to meet with Parents and Athlete
- Assist clients in navigating junior hockey opportunities
- Contact College Ice Hockey Coaches at the Usports, D3, and D1 levels to determine if there is a fit for your clients.
- Assist your clients and their families decide which scholarship offer is in the best interests of the client.
- Adhere to and Implement the NEPD Development Plan
Requirements:
- A dedicated work-ethic and a willingness to learn;
- Passion to work in hockey and in helping kids achieve their dreams.
- Previous hockey experience is an asset
